Webster's 1913 Dictionary
TEASPOON
TEASPOON Tea "spoon `, n.
Defn: A small spoon used in stirring and sipping tea, coffee, etc. , and for other purposes.
TEASPOONFUL
Tea "spoon `ful, n.; pl. Teaspoonfuls (.
Defn: As much as teaspoon will hold; enough to fill a teaspoon; -- usually reckoned at a fluid dram or one quarter of a tablespoonful.
New American Oxford Dictionary
teaspoon
tea spoon |ˈtēˌspo͞on ˈtiˌspun | ▶noun a small spoon used typically for adding sugar to and stirring hot drinks or for eating some soft foods. • (abbr.: tsp. or t ) a measurement used in cooking, equivalent to 1 /6 fluid ounce, 1 /3 tablespoon, or 4.9 ml. DERIVATIVES tea spoon ful |-ˌfo͝ol |noun ( pl. teaspoonfuls )
Oxford Dictionary
teaspoon
tea |spoon |ˈtiːspuːn | ▶noun a small spoon used typically for adding sugar to and stirring hot drinks or for eating some foods. • (abbrev.: tsp ) the amount held by a teaspoon, in the UK considered to be 5 millilitres when used as a measurement in cookery. DERIVATIVES teaspoonful noun ( pl. teaspoonfuls )
